Multiple Sclerosis (MS) is a chronic disease where the immune system attacks the central nervous system, including the brain and spinal cord. This damages the protective layer around nerve fibers, disrupting communication throughout the body. While MS is known for causing fatigue and mobility issues, a common symptom is light sensitivity, medically termed photophobia. This heightened reaction can significantly impact daily life.
Light Sensitivity as an MS Symptom
Photophobia in MS is a painful or highly uncomfortable reaction, not just a simple aversion to bright light. Patients often report intense discomfort or a burning sensation when exposed to natural sunlight or artificial sources like fluorescent bulbs and digital screens. This symptom can range from mild annoyance to a debilitating condition requiring immediate relief.
Vision problems are common initial symptoms of MS, and light sensitivity is closely linked to these issues. The discomfort is distinct from typical eyestrain, often involving eye pain or triggering headaches, particularly migraines, which are also common in the MS population. Bright light can also exacerbate general MS fatigue and cause temporary cognitive symptoms.
Understanding the Neurological Cause
The heightened sensitivity to light in MS is directly rooted in the disease’s pathology, which targets the central nervous system. MS causes demyelination and inflammation in the brain and spinal cord. This damage frequently involves the optic nerve, resulting in optic neuritis, which is a common visual problem in MS.
When the optic nerve is inflamed or damaged, the transmission of visual signals from the retina to the brain is impaired. This disruption causes the visual system to become hyper-reactive to light input. MS lesions can also affect visual processing pathways in the brainstem and visual cortex, leading to misfiring signals interpreted as pain or discomfort upon light exposure.
Scientists also propose that the trigeminal nerve, which transmits sensation and pain from the face and eyes, plays a role in MS-related photophobia. Damage along this pathway contributes to the painful response to light.
Strategies for Symptom Relief
Managing MS-related light sensitivity involves environmental adjustments and specialized tools. Modifying the home and work environment offers significant relief, such as swapping harsh overhead lighting for warmer, soft-toned LED bulbs. Adjusting digital device settings, including dimming screens and utilizing “night mode” or blue-light filters, helps reduce triggering light frequencies.
Specialized eyewear is an effective tool against photophobia. Precision-tinted lenses, such as the FL-41 tint, filter out specific wavelengths of light, particularly in the blue-green spectrum (480–520 nm). These lenses reduce the impact of fluorescent lights and glare, offering relief that standard sunglasses often cannot provide.
Discuss persistent light sensitivity with a healthcare provider, as it may signal an acute flare-up or optic neuritis. Medication adjustments, such as corticosteroids, may be considered to reduce underlying inflammation.
